We offer factory original clear anodizing and paint, black centers with anodized lips, RSR finish, custom paint and polish, polishing, and other restoration options depending on the wheel.
Yes. Average curb rash, scratches, and minor imperfections can often be repaired during the restoration process.
In many cases, yes. We can restore certain bent or damaged wheels if they can be safely returned to roadworthy condition. Photos should be sent first for review.
Some gouges and cracks may be repairable depending on the wheel. If welding is required, there may be slight discoloration after restoration, especially in the repaired area.
Date stamps, markings, part numbers, and Fuchs foxes are preserved whenever possible. If you choose to have the backs serviced, ink stamps may not be preserved.
Yes. Please ship wheels only. Tires and lug nuts should be removed before shipping.
Use strong boxes with packing material on all sides. A 20x20x10 box is usually recommended for one wheel. Add protective cardboard around the rim area to prevent shipping damage.
Send clear photos of each wheel along with details about the finish or service you want. This allows Fuchs Restoration to review condition and provide the most accurate estimate.
Yes, caps can be restored in anodized or black finish. However, because caps are thin, deep gouges or scuffs may still be visible, and replacement may be recommended in some cases.
